ive started to notice a slight vibration during take off in my 98 ram 1500 4x4..it only "vibrates" after driving a good distance at higher speeds 60-70mph and only does it when i get back into stop and go traffic...runs fine down the highway,shift fine and nothing out of the ordinary but once i get back into town and stop and take off it vibrates for a second or 2 until i get going,it felt likeit was coming from the front end,but it did it last night an di opened my door and stuck my head out when i took off to get a better listen and it sounded liek ti was coming from somewhere in the rear. i can drive all day in town and have no problems but once i drive it on the high way for a bit itll start doing it...like i said there is no shifting problems or braking problems that are noticable...do yall think it could possibly a bearing somewhere or maybe brakes grabbing? i wa shaving a leak problem in my transfer case but it magicly stopped? would a problem with the transfer case cause a vibration or grind when taking off?...so far no major problems that keep me from driving it its just annoying and im afraid that vibration wil llead to a bigger problem. any help will be appricated..thanks
check drive shaft ujoints with park brake on/wheels chocked (don't get run over), trans in neutral, this should create no pressure on drive shaft, inspect ujoint seals and try to wiggle shaft, if you have then - use big channel locks to wiggle shaft, any play at all is bad. same with front shaft.
don't put it off - mine went from 'a little play' squeak/vibration to 'about ready to fall out', in only 2 days, in fact all the needle bearings fell completely out. then it vibrated a LOT.
